Foundation Sealing in Greenville, SC
Foundation sealing services involve applying specialized materials to the exterior or interior of a building’s foundation to prevent water infiltration and protect against moisture damage. This process is commonly used on residential properties with basements, crawl spaces, or slab foundations, especially in areas prone to heavy rainfall or high humidity. Property owners often request foundation sealing when they notice signs of water leaks, cracks, or moisture buildup around their foundation, aiming to maintain structural integrity and avoid costly repairs caused by water intrusion.
Before requesting foundation sealing, homeowners should consider the current condition of their foundation and identify any existing cracks, gaps, or areas of deterioration. Understanding the extent of moisture issues and whether there are underlying drainage problems can help determine the most effective sealing approach. Proper surface preparation and selecting the right sealing materials are essential for long-lasting results. Consulting with a professional can provide guidance on the appropriate type of sealant and ensure that the project addresses specific property needs effectively.

Common Foundation Sealing Jobs
Foundation Sealing - helps prevent water infiltration and reduces basement moisture issues.
Crack Sealing - addresses small foundation cracks to stop water leaks and further damage.
Wall Sealing - protects foundation walls from water penetration and soil pressure.
Basement Sealing - creates a moisture barrier to improve indoor air quality and prevent mold.
Slab Sealing - seals concrete slabs to prevent water seepage and soil erosion beneath the foundation.
Waterproofing - enhances overall foundation durability by blocking water entry points.
Foundation Sealing Questions
What is foundation sealing? Foundation sealing involves applying a waterproof barrier to prevent water infiltration and protect the foundation from moisture damage.
When should foundation sealing be considered? Sealing is recommended when cracks, moisture issues, or water seepage are observed around the foundation.
What types of foundations can benefit from sealing? Most foundation types, including basement, crawl space, and slab foundations, can benefit from sealing to improve durability.
How does foundation sealing help property owners? It helps prevent water damage, reduces basement humidity, and can improve the overall stability of the foundation.
